@charset "utf-8";
/* CSS Document */

.step_one_individual {
	width: 50%;
	float: left;
	padding:10px 0;
	line-height:1.6em;
}

.step_one_group {
	line-height:1.6em;
	width: 50%;
	float: left;
	padding:10px 0;
	/* */
}

.roster_options input {
	margin-left: 16px;
}

.step_one_individual #loader,
.step_one_group #loader{
	margin: 0px 0px -3px 6px;
}

label.application_label {
	width: 25%;
	float: left;
	display: block;
}

input.application_input,
select.application_input,
textarea.application_input {
	width: 65%;
}

label.application_label_col_one {
	width: 25%;
	float: left;
	display: block;
	
}

input.application_input_col_one,
select.application_input_col_one,
textarea.application_input_col_one {
	width: 25%;
	float: left;
}

label.application_label_col_two {
	width: 12%;
	float: left;
	display: block;
	margin-left: 3%;
}

input.application_input_col_two,
select.application_input_col_two,
textarea.application_input_col_two {
	width: 25%;
	float: none;
}

input.documentation,
input.documentation_more {
	width: 30%;
	height: 20px;
	font-size: 11px;
	line-height: 20px;
	border: none;
}

input.documentation_more {
	margin: 5px 0px 0px 25%;
}

small.documentation_notice {
	width: 30%;
	float: right;
	display: block;
	line-height: 14px;
	margin-right: 10%;
}

.error {
	background-color: #ff8888 !important;
}
